Publication | Closed Access
Building dependable COTS microkernel-based systems using MAFALDA
25
Citations
10
References
2002
Year
Unknown Venue
EngineeringMicrokernel AssessmentCommercial MicrokernelsComputer ArchitectureSoftware EngineeringEmbedded SystemsDependable System ArchitectureSoftware AnalysisHardware SecurityReliability EngineeringCots MicrokernelsFailure AnalysisSystems EngineeringFailure DetectionReliabilityOs-level VirtualizationMicroservices DesignComputer EngineeringFault ManagementProgram AnalysisSoftware TestingFault InjectionSystem Software
MAFALDA (Microkernel Assessment by Fault injection Analysis and Design Aid) is a generic tool providing quantitative information on COTS microkernels to support their integration into dependable systems. The main originality of MAFALDA relies on the features provided for both the analysis of the failure modes of the target microkernel and the design of error confinement wrappers. The paper illustrates: (i) how MAFALDA is organized and its user interface, and (ii) how it can be used to carry out fault injection campaigns. Finally, we present the experimental context of campaigns carried out on two commercial microkernels and draw the main lessons learnt.
| Year | Citations | |
|---|---|---|
Page 1
Page 1